Bull logo Bull

Bull is a Node library that implements a fast and robust queue system based on redis.

SignalR logo SignalR

SignalR is a server-side software system designed for writing scalable Internet applications, notably web servers.

12 Most Preferred latest .NET Libraries of 2022
SignalR offers real-time web integration for .NET core apps through its SignalR .NET core library. Using it, developers can push/add data from the server into their applications. Features: Automatic connection management. Simultaneous message-sending to all clients. Scalable to handle increasing traffic. A group of clients can be notified at once with a message.

SignalR Alternatives
SignalR is basically used to allow connection between client and server or vice-versa. It is a type of bi-directional communication between both the client and server. SignalR is compatible with web sockets and many other connections, which help in the direct push of content over the server. There are many alternatives for signalR that are used, like Firebase, pusher,...

  • I'm new to C#, have a little C++ and Java experience from high school and college. My goal is to make an application for two players to play Go.
    Since Go is a pretty simple game and not very graphic intensive, a simple approach would be to use SignalR on ASP.NET, where the server maintains the game board state and just sends minimal messages (for example, piece X moved to location Y, and whose turn it is now) to each player after their respective move in turn.
